Transconductance (for transfer conductance), also infrequently called mutual conductance, is the electrical characteristic relating the current through the output of a device per the voltage across the input of a device.
Sharp-cutoff ("high slope" or ordinary) pentodes have the more ordinary uniform spacing of grid wires, and so mutual conductance decreases in an essentially uniform manner with increasing negative bias, and has a more abrupt cutoff.
The mutual conductance tester tests the tube dynamically by applying bias and an AC voltage to the control grid, and measuring the current obtained on the plate, while maintaining the correct DC voltages on the plate and screen grid.
